Whitchurch station is equipped with essential amenities to facilitate a smooth journey. Although there is no ticket office, you’ll find a ticket machine where you can collect tickets bought online using a major debit or credit card. For those requiring assistance, there are help points available, and information screens provide details of departure and arrival times.
Accessibility is a key feature at the station with step-free access available on Platform 2, which services routes to Crewe. For traveling to Shrewsbury on Platform 1, note that access is via a footbridge with 44 steps. Passenger assist services are available with requests being required at least two hours before departure.
The station has 31 parking spaces available 24/7, along with dedicated accessible parking spots. Though lacking in refreshment shops and waiting lounges, the station still maintains a friendly environment with seating areas present.
When it comes to continuing your journey from Whitchurch, you’ll find convenient transport links right by the station. A rail replacement bus service operates, collecting passengers from nearby Station Road. Although there are no bicycle hire facilities, cycling enthusiasts can make use of the six bicycle stands available on the Crewe-bound platform. While taxis and car hire services aren't specified at the station, local options within Whitchurch are readily available for hire if needed.

Saunderton Station might not have a ticket office, but there are ticket machines available, providing a convenient way to collect tickets purchased online. All machines are card-only, making cash transactions a thing of the past. While the station might not have round-the-clock staffing, it does offer a customer help point for those in need. If assistance is required, there's always the Passenger Assist service, which can be booked up to two hours in advance of your journey.
For those with mobility needs, it's important to note the station’s step-free access is limited. Access to Platform 2 is available, serving northbound services towards Aylesbury and beyond. However, if Platform 1 is your destination, you’ll need to traverse a footbridge, or alternatively, a taxi can be arranged to nearby stations like High Wycombe or Princes Risborough with better accessibility.
Saunderton offers excellent connections, making it easy to traverse the region even if you're not driving. Rail replacement services and local buses ensure you're well-connected, with stops conveniently located a mere three-minute walk from the station entrance on the main road, A4010.
